Kión ceviche + tapas...

Kim visited, and dragged James out too with us for a lovely little meal @ Kión on E. 6th st and Ave A: Japanese peruvian food...the pictures speak for themselves....:) Had sushi too last time but that was "meh" in comparison to everything else...^_^

Sweet plaintains on the side (w/ what I think was condensed milk drippings!)
Sweetness (plaintains @ kion's)...

Spicy mussels (wok roasted mussels with rocoto peppers, ginger, cilantro and miso broth)
miso mussels @ kion's...

Pulpito (Chilled baby octopus and sautéed octopus tentacles with panca miso garlic ginger sauce)
baby octopus tapas @ kion's...

Toro con palta (tuna belly tartar with avocado mousse, capers and ceviche lime juice)
toro con palta @ Kion's...

James got pan seared filet mignon with a fried quail egg topping and blue potato gnocchi side...

Lychee martini...

Ceviche mixto (shrimp, squid, snapper and fluke marinated in a spicy ceviche sauce)

Anticuchos and Papa a la Huancaina (grilled miso-panca marinated beef, shrimp and chicken skewers served with blue potatoes with feta cheese sauce and kalamata aioli)

Also had the Pepino Rollo (cucumber rolls stuffed with salmon, avocado and seared tuna in a sesame Yuzu sauce) but last time I had the Salmon Yuzu and that was much better--same concept ish with the cucumber hollowed and filled with salmon and yuzu sauce.
